【java-我们可以添加多个SQL驱动程序,例如OTD,MySQL Connector / J,PostgreSQL,SyBase JConnect等吗?】教程文章相关的互联网学习教程文章

java – 如何在发生异常后使用PostgreSQL在Spring Boot中继续事务?【代码】

我创建了一个创建用户帐户的服务方法.如果由于给定的电子邮件地址已经在我们的数据库中而导致创建失败,我想向用户发送一封电子邮件,说明他们已经注册:@Transactional(noRollbackFor=DuplicateEmailException.class) void registerUser(User user) {try {userRepository.create(user);catch(DuplicateEmailException e) {User registeredUser = userRepository.findByEmail(user.getEmail());mailService.sendAlreadyRegisteredEma...

如何使用Java中的Postgres JDBC驱动程序获取导致SQLException的sql语句?

背景 在我目前的项目中 – 没有GUI前端的服务器产品,我正在尝试编写更好的错误处理支持.当前错误输出到日志,通常不被用户读取. 我们使用PostgreSQL作为我们的数据库后端,我们使用直接JDBC调用和DAO通过数据库池来访问它.大多数与数据库相关的异常都包含在一个实现RuntimeException的通用DatabaseException类中,并尝试从传递的异常中提取调试和状态信息.在我们的特定情况下,它将访问底层的PostgreSQL数据库驱动程序 – PSQLExcepti...

java – OFFSET N FETCH FIRST M ROWS,JDBC和PostgreSQL无法正常工作【代码】

我正在尝试使用JDBC和PostgreSQL进行查询,但我遇到了一个奇怪的情况,我在任何文档中都找不到. 如果我通过pgAdmin和H2(我用于我的应用程序的单元测试)执行它,以下查询有效,但如果我通过JDBC执行它,我会收到语法错误: Queries.SELECT_SQLSELECT columns FROM Table LEFT JOIN TableToJoin1 LEFT JOIN TableToJoin2 LEFT JOIN TableToJoin3 JOIN TableToJoin4Queries.ENDING_PAGING_STATEMENT_SQLOFFSET ? ROWS FETCH FIRST ? ROWS O...

java – 如何使用Grails 3.0配置PostgreSQL?【代码】

我使用IntelliJ IDEA 15.0.2作为IDE.我已经创建了一个Grails 3.0应用程序,并对其进行了一些更改以配置PostgreSQL. 这是我的dataSource:dataSource: pooled: true jmxExport: true driverClassName: org.postgresql.Driver username: postgres password: rootenvironments: development:dataSource:dbCreate: updateurl: jdbc:postgresql://localhost:5432/trace_db test:dataSource:dbCreate: updateurl: jdbc:postgresql://local...

Java连接postgreSQL数据库,找不到表。【代码】

postgreSQL数据库遵守SQL标准,表名库名不区分大小写。 数据库中是存在 gongan_address_ALL的表的,但是执行下列代码就会出错。1 stmt = c.createStatement(); 2 String sql = "SELECT * FROM gongan_address_ALL "; 3 ResultSet rs = stmt.executeQuery( sql );报错为org.postgresql.util.PSQLException: ERROR: relation "gongan_address_all" does not exist这是由于表名被...

java 使用jdbc连接Greenplum数据库和Postgresql数据库【代码】

1、公司使用的Greenplum和Postgresql,确实让我学到不少东西。简单将使用jdbc连接Greenplum和Postgresql数据库。由于使用maven仓库,不能下载Greenplum的jar包,但是可以下载Postgresql的jar包,所以Greenplum的jar包,自己可以百度自行下载。名字就叫做greenplum.jar。 maven依赖如下所示:<!-- https://mvnrepository.com/artifact/org.postgresql/postgresql --> <dependency><groupId>org.postgresql</groupId><artifactId>pos...

linux下java发送post请求以及安全证书问题【代码】【图】

Linux下Java发送post请求,header为application/x-www-form-urlencoded。 1.添加依赖<dependency><groupId>commons-httpclient</groupId><artifactId>commons-httpclient</artifactId><version>3.1</version> </dependency> 2.代码实现:String url = "https://192.5.52.194:8868/nifi-api/access/token";PostMethod postMethod = new PostMethod(url);postMethod.setRequestHeader("Content-Type", "application/x-www-form-urle...

[Javaee] Ubuntu下载Postman【代码】【图】

1、下载选择合适机型进行下载 2、解压移动到/opt 目录并进行解压  #转移到/opt tab自动补全名字 sudo cp Postman-linux-x64-7.2.2.tar.gz /opt#去/opt 解压 sudo tar -zxvf Postman-linux-x64-7.2.2.tar.gz 3、打开Postman在/opt 目录下 输入如下sudo ./Postman/Postman 我出现了如下报错: ./Postman/Postman: error while loading shared libraries: libgconf-2.so.4: cannot open shared object file: No such fi...

POSTGRESQL - 相关标签
CONNECT - 相关标签